Add 42/12 and 63/40
1st number: 3 6/12, 2nd number: 1 23/40
42/12 + 63/40 is 203/40.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 12 and 40 is 120
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 120 - For the 1st fraction, since 12 × 10 = 120,
42/12 = 42 × 10/12 × 10 = 420/120 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 40 × 3 = 120,
63/40 = 63 × 3/40 × 3 = 189/120 - Add the two like fractions:
420/120 + 189/120 = 420 + 189/120 = 609/120 - 609/120 simplified gives 203/40
- So, 42/12 + 63/40 = 203/40
